What case is it? And how do you deal connecting the guitar cable and power line?

It’s a Pedaltrain Metro Max with the case. I need to lift the pedalboard out of the case, and then plug the Noble into AC power. The Noble powers the rest.

The board goes tuner into JHS into Cali76 into SGT into Noble. I arranged it as you see so the output jacks would be accessible at the back or sides in case I feel like taking the signal from an earlier stage and calling it a day.
